In the DB logs I can see the query
SET client_min_messages = warning; SET TIME ZONE INTERVAL %s HOUR TO MINUTE
being run multiple times. From the code I can see that this query is added every time a new connection is being established with the DB. But from the logs I can see that sometimes these queries are being run sequentially one after the other, and are not paired with some other query. Does this query have any impact on the performance, and should I disable this query completely?I'm using sequelize version
6.29.0
, along with @nestjs/sequelize with version8.0.0
